2-{2-[(E)-(5-methoxy-6-oxocyclohexa-2,4-dien-1-ylidene)methyl]hydrazino}-N,N,N-trimethyl-2-oxoethanaminium chloride

Base Information
  • Chemical Name:2-{2-[(E)-(5-methoxy-6-oxocyclohexa-2,4-dien-1-ylidene)methyl]hydrazino}-N,N,N-trimethyl-2-oxoethanaminium chloride
  • CAS No.:6958-21-0
  • Molecular Formula:C13H20 N3 O3 . Cl
  • Molecular Weight:301.7692
  • Hs Code.:
2-{2-[(E)-(5-methoxy-6-oxocyclohexa-2,4-dien-1-ylidene)methyl]hydrazino}-N,N,N-trimethyl-2-oxoethanaminium chloride

Synonyms:Ammonium,(carboxymethyl)trimethyl-, chloride, (3-methoxysalicylidene)hydrazide (8CI);NSC 64609
